Joseph Mocanu is the Managing Partner at Verge HealthTech Fund, based in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. He oversees a portfolio of more than 20 early-stage digital health startups, managing over $100 million in assets under management following the $85 million close of Fund II in March 2024. Prior to his current role, he gained venture capital experience through an investment position at Golden Ventures and served as a Principal at the management consulting firm Oliver Wyman. Mocanu holds a doctorate in Medical Biophysics from the University of Toronto and has guided notable portfolio exits, including the public listing of Think Research. In early 2026, he expanded his governance duties by joining the board of directors at CareMind Systems. His ongoing focus centers on financing early-stage medical technology ventures that bridge software engineering with global healthcare accessibility.
